Description
A delightful and easy-to-make Fresh Cherry Cobbler Recipe featuring tart or sweet fresh cherries with a buttery biscuit-like topping. This cobbler is perfect for any occasion and pairs wonderfully with a scoop of vanilla ice cream or whipped cream.
Ingredients
2 cups sour cherries, pitted (or substitute with sweet cherries, adjusting sugar)
1/2 cup butter
1 cup all-purpose flour
1 cup granulated sugar, divided
1 teaspoon baking powder
1 cup milk
1 tablespoon all-purpose flour (for tossing with cherries)
Instructions
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Place the butter in a 9×13-inch baking dish and melt it in the oven for about 5 minutes.
In a medium bowl, combine flour, 3/4 cup sugar, and baking powder. Stir to combine, then add the milk and mix to create a smooth batter.
Once the butter is melted, pour the batter into the dish over the melted butter. Do not stir.
Toss the cherries with 1 tablespoon of flour and 3/4 cup sugar, then evenly spread the cherries on top of the batter. Do not stir.
Bake for 50-60 minutes, or until the top is golden brown and a toothpick comes out clean.
Let cool slightly before serving. Optionally, top with vanilla ice cream or whipped cream.
